Lektionsindhold -- Tastaturgenvej: 'u'  Forrige side: Sammensætning af tekststrenge - illustration -- Tastaturgenvej: 'p'  Næste side: Kopiering af tekststrenge - illustration -- Tastaturgenvej: 'n'  Forelæsningsnoter - alle slides sammen  Alfabetisk indeks  Hjælp om disse noter  Kursets hjemmeside    Tekststrenge - slide 22 : 38

Sammensætning af tekststrenge

char *strcat(char *s1, const char *s2)

Funktionen strcat indsætter strengen s2 i bagenden af en anden streng s1 forudsat der er plads efter nultegnet

#include <stdio.h>
#include <string.h>

int main(void) {

  char s[25] = "Aalborg";  
  char t[] = "University";
  char *res;

  res = strcat(strcat(s," "),t);
  printf("%s: %i chars\n", res, strlen(s));
  
  return 0;
}
cat-ex-output
Output fra programmet.